Webgroups. In both cases, a common constituent is always found: the epoxy monomer. The main feature of the epoxy monomer is the oxirane functional group, which is a three member ring formed between two carbon atoms and an oxygen, as shown in Figure 1. WebThe phenyl groups also increase the refractive index. Trifluoropropyl groups along the chain change the solubility parameter of the polymer from 15.3 MPa 1/2 to 19.4 MPa 1/2, which reduces the swelling of silicone elastomers in alkane and aromatic solvents.
